How they compare
Brazil currently reports 1.28 against 1.27 in British Virgin Islands, a difference of 0.01.
Across all 32 years both countries report, Brazil has been ahead every year.
Brazil ranks 110th and British Virgin Islands ranks 112th of 198 countries.
Brazil has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Brazil | British Virgin Islands |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 2 | 1.71 | 0.2912 | Brazil |
| 2000s | 1.74 | 1.6 | 0.1365 | Brazil |
| 2010s | 1.52 | 1.44 | 0.0887 | Brazil |
| 2020s | 1.31 | 1.28 | 0.0223 | Brazil |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
